#975238 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#975238 is composed of 59.2% red, 32.2%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.7% magenta, 62.9%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 16.4 degrees, a saturation of 45.9% and a lightness of 40.6%. #975238 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a470 with #2f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#975238 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#975238 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#975238 has RGB values of R:151, G:82,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.63,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9916984.
